We are able to draw on a number of trusted Associates. Not only do they allow us to meet the demands of larger projects, we are proud of the challenge, diversity and breadth of thinking they bring to Oak Grove.
John Bee
John is a Director at White Space Strategy and he is an expert at using consumer research methods to drive strategic outputs, based on his broad knowledge of statistical modelling. He also runs White Space’s pro bono practice. He is a member of Helen & Douglas House's Corporate Advisory Group, a non-executive role supporting the world's first children's hospice and also holds an advisory position with The National Autistic Society. John holds a degree in History from Cambridge University, and professional qualifications from the Chartered Institute of Marketing.

Rebecca Nestor
Rebecca is Director at Learning For Good, providing Learning and Development services for the third sector. She has expertise in facilitation, leadership development, employee engagement for sustainability, equality and diversity, women's development, personality profiling (MBTI and TMP) for leadership and team building. Rebecca is a Fellow of the Chartered Institute of Personnel and Development and has an English Literature degree from Cambridge University as well as an MBA from the Open University Business School.

Dennis Pannozzo
Dennis is an experienced strategy and innovation adviser with over 25 years of industry and consulting experience. He has specific expertise in financial services, insurance and utilities. His focus is on conceiving and taking to market new growth strategies and sustainable new propositions, business models and disruptive business ventures. Dennis holds an MBA from INSEAD and is a graduate of GE Capital’s Management Development Programme.

Polly Courtney
Polly has been a strategy and growth consultant for over ten years, working across multiple sectors including utilities, FMCG, media and publishing. She is passionate about bringing an entrepreneurial approach into big business and delivering fast, tangible results for clients. She is author of the UK's first business novel, Defying Gravity - Adventures of a Corporate Entrepreneur and a number of other best selling books. Polly is also founding director of Girls in Football.com and holds an Engineering degree from Cambridge University.

Tony Peck
Tony has extensive experience in developing growth options and strategies, and in conceiving and implementing new customer propositions, business ventures, products and services. Tony’s experience spans multiple sectors, and he has specific expertise in financial services, insurance, telecoms and charities. He has also worked with British Gas and Tesco on corporate responsibility programmes. He holds an MBA from the Cranfield School of Management and a BSc Management Science from the University of St. Andrews.

Liz Taylor
Liz is Director at Wow@Work helping organisations build smart skills in their workforce. She designs and delivers learning programmes that boost creative thinking and transform communication capabilities. She spent 15 years with Logistix Limited, one of the UK’s most successful independent marketing companies, becoming MD in 2001. Liz is a member of the British Psychological Society, The Association of Business Psychologists and the Special Group for Coaching Psychologists. She holds an MSc, Organizational Psychology from Birkbeck and a PGDip, Psychology from Oxford Brookes University.
